Donegal Death Notices – Rest in Peace

written by Staff Writer September 16, 2017
FacebookTweetLinkedInPrint

Donegal death notices for today, Saturday, September 16.

 

Trevor PEOPLES
The death has occurred of Trevor Peoples, 398 Ard Baithin, St Johnston, Donegal.

Reposing at his late residence since yesterday evening. Removal on Sunday at 12.30pm to St. Baithin’s Church, St. Johnston for Requiem Mass at 1pm with burial afterwards in the adjoining cemetery. Family flowers only please. Donations in lieu, if desired, to Intensive Care Unit, Letterkenny University Hospital.

 

Màire MC ELROY
The death has occurred in Glasgow of Màire Mc Elroy of Magheroarty, Gortahork, Co Donegal. Survived by her three sons, daughter, brothers, sister, in laws, nieces, nephews, family and friends.

Funeral from Glasgow on Monday, the 18th September, to arrive at Christ the King Church, Gortahork for 7.00pm. Funeral Mass on Tuesday, the 19th, at 11.00am with burial afterwards in the adjacent cemetery.

 

Kathleen LESTER (née Kelly)
The death has occurred of Kathleen Lester (née Kelly) (Parnell Street, Sallynoggin and formerly of Kiltoal, Convoy, Co. Donegal) – September 14th 2017 peacefully but suddenly at her home. Kathleen; beloved wife of the late Willie. She will be very sadly missed by her loving sons, daughters, grandchildren, great-grandchildren, brother, sister, brother-in-law, sister-in-law, her extended family, relatives and friends.

Removal this Tuesday morning from Patrick O’Donovan and Son Funeral Home, Sallynoggin (opp. Sallynoggin Church) to Our Lady of Victories Church, Sallynoggin arriving at 9.50am. Funeral immediately after 10am Requiem Mass to St. Mary’s Old Cemetery, Convoy, Co. Donegal arriving at 3.30pm approx. Family flowers only please. Donations, if desired, to the Alzheimer’s Society of Ireland. Donation box at rear of Church.

 

Christopher COLLUMB
The death has occurred in Glasgow of Christopher Collumb formerly of Ardsbeg, Gortahork, Co Donegal. Survived by his mother Helen and two sisters, brothers in law, nephews, grandparents, aunts, uncles, large circle of family and friends.

Funeral from Glasgow to Christ the King Church, Gortahork tomorrow, Saturday, the 16th September, to arrive between 4.00 and 4.30pm. Funeral Mass on Sunday, the 17th, at 1.00pm with burial afterwards in the adjacent cemetery.

 

Isabel CAIN
The death has occurred of Isabel Cain, Rockhill, Balintra, Co. Donegal. Peacefully, at the Shiel Hospital, Ballyshannon.

Reposing at her late residence in Rockhill, Ballintra on Saturday from 3 o’clock to 11 o’clock. Funeral arriving at St Brigid’s Church, Ballintra, for Mass of the resurrection at 11 o’clock on Sunday with interment in the adjoining cemetery. Family flowers only. Donations in lieu, if so desired, to the Shiel Hospital Patients Comfort Fund c/o Patrick McKenna Funeral Directors, Ballyshannon or any family member.

 

Michael MC GETTIGAN
The death has occurred of Michael Mc Gettigan, Ard Cuílin, The Glebe, Donegal town, peacefully in The Donegal Hospice Letterkenny.

Remains reposing at his late residence from 2pm today (Saturday). Remains will leave his late residence on Sunday at 6:30pm to arrive at St Patrick’s Church Donegal Town for 7pm. Funeral Mass on Monday morning at 11am in St Patrick’s Church Donegal Town with burial immediately afterwards in Clar cemetery. House Private please. Family flowers only please donations if so desired to the Donegal Hospital, Letterkenny care of any family member.
